ME 151 - Introduction to Mechanical Engineering II (3 units) Introduces the Product Realization Process, project management, team skills, feature-based solid modeling, and geometric tolerancing. Discussion of career options; computer lab; design projects.
Prerequisite(s): ENGR 100 .
Units of Lecture: 1 Units of Laboratory/Studio: 2 Offered Every Spring Student Learning Outcomes (if available): Upon completion of this course:
